草庐IT

pull-requests

全部标签

端口映射问题:Bad Request This combination of host and port requires TLS.

错误信息:BadRequestThiscombinationofhostandportrequiresTLS.遇到上面的错误信息:如果是通过域名访问,则该域名后配置的转发端口映射错误。如果是通过ip+端口或者域名+端口访问,则为你端口填写错误。我出现过若干次以上问题,所以将其记录,原因为在配置端口时,为服务配置了一个serverport一个httpport。但在访问的时候访问了serverport。就访问不到了。

【python】python运行脚本出现InsecureRequestWarning:Unverified HTTPS request is being made to host错误

问题原因大概意思就是没有正在向主机发出未经验证的HTTPS请求,所以需要关闭校验解决流程添加requests.packages.urllib3.disable_warnings()verify=Falseproxies={"http":None,"https":None,}header={'User-Agent':'Mozilla/5.0(WindowsNT10.0;Win64;x64)AppleWebKit/537.36(KHTML,likeGecko)Chrome/87.0.4280.40Safari/537.36Edg/87.0.664.24'}requests.packages.url

Go - http Request.Write(),将长请求传递给 Writer 而不会被切断?

创建请求,然后写入varwCustomWriterreq,_:=http.NewRequest("POST","/Foo",bytes.NewReader([]byte()))req.Write(w)func(w*CustomWriter)Write(request[]byte)(int,error){fmt.Println(len(request))return0,nil}输出:4096但我的请求正文明显更长,但在尝试编写时却被截断了。我如何编写和发送这个具有很长主体的HTTP请求,而不丢失或切断主体? 最佳答案 这不是您在Go中

Go - http Request.Write(),将长请求传递给 Writer 而不会被切断?

创建请求,然后写入varwCustomWriterreq,_:=http.NewRequest("POST","/Foo",bytes.NewReader([]byte()))req.Write(w)func(w*CustomWriter)Write(request[]byte)(int,error){fmt.Println(len(request))return0,nil}输出:4096但我的请求正文明显更长,但在尝试编写时却被截断了。我如何编写和发送这个具有很长主体的HTTP请求,而不丢失或切断主体? 最佳答案 这不是您在Go中

git - 如何从 git 源 pull 并推送到另一个

我正在使用golang(goget)从github.com(各种repos)获取代码到本地repoc:\gopath\src\...但是,之后我无法将这些推送到本地位桶服务器。但是,如果我从github下载zip并解压,然后我可以推送到本地源代码repo。我做错了吗?否则应该怎么办?谢谢 最佳答案 您需要为您pull的每个存储库添加一个gitremote。$gitremoteaddbitbuckethttps://mybitbucketserver.example.com/bitbucket/projects/repo.git当你需

git - 如何从 git 源 pull 并推送到另一个

我正在使用golang(goget)从github.com(各种repos)获取代码到本地repoc:\gopath\src\...但是,之后我无法将这些推送到本地位桶服务器。但是,如果我从github下载zip并解压,然后我可以推送到本地源代码repo。我做错了吗?否则应该怎么办?谢谢 最佳答案 您需要为您pull的每个存储库添加一个gitremote。$gitremoteaddbitbuckethttps://mybitbucketserver.example.com/bitbucket/projects/repo.git当你需

python requests设置连接超时时间

这段代码的主要作用是使用requests库发出一个GET请求,并设置连接超时时间为5秒钟,读取超时时间为10秒钟。如果请求超时,就会抛出requests.exceptions.Timeout异常,并在"except"语句块中进行处理。如果发生其他类型的错误,如连接错误,就会抛出requests.exceptions.ConnectionError异常,并在相应的"except"语句块中进行处理。具体来说,这段代码首先导入了requests库,然后使用try-except语句块来捕获可能发生的异常。在try语句块中,我们使用requests.get()方法发出一个GET请求,并将timeout参

github - 用于 git pull 的 Golang 工具?

我试图让不太懂技术的人也能轻松地将我的golang程序用作命令行应用程序。当我将更改推送到github时,我希望他们也能够轻松地更新代码。有没有一种方法可以使用诸如“goupdategithub.com/user/repo”之类的东西来更新库,这样他们就不必cd到src目录然后gitpull自己?或者此时我必须简单地说“是时候学习git了”? 最佳答案 您可以使用:goget-u导入/路径The-uflaginstructsgettousethenetworktoupdatethenamedpackagesandtheirdepen

github - 用于 git pull 的 Golang 工具?

我试图让不太懂技术的人也能轻松地将我的golang程序用作命令行应用程序。当我将更改推送到github时,我希望他们也能够轻松地更新代码。有没有一种方法可以使用诸如“goupdategithub.com/user/repo”之类的东西来更新库,这样他们就不必cd到src目录然后gitpull自己?或者此时我必须简单地说“是时候学习git了”? 最佳答案 您可以使用:goget-u导入/路径The-uflaginstructsgettousethenetworktoupdatethenamedpackagesandtheirdepen

戈朗 : How to simulate a POST with a form request?

我一直在网上搜索,但找不到太多关于在golang测试中发布表单的信息。这是我的尝试。不过,我收到错误消息“拨号tcp:地址::1中的冒号太多”。如果我将地址更改为“http://localhost:8080/”,我会得到“dialtcp127.0.0.1:8080:connectionrefused”。我读到过如果将(IPv6)地址放在括号中,括号会解决问题,但随后我会收到无法识别的协议(protocol)错误。varaddr="http://::1/"h:=handlers.GetHandler()server:=httptest.NewServer(h)server.URL=add